Guadeloupe

(Angielski)

  1. An island at the northeastern edge of the Caribbean.
  2. An archipelago, overseas department, and administrative region of France, including the island of Guadeloupe.

Wymawiane jako (IPA)
/ɡwɑːdə.ˈluːp/
Etymologia (Angielski)

From French Guadeloupe, from Spanish Santa María de Guadalupe (The Virgin Mary named after the Spanish town of Guadalupe in Extremadura). Doublet of Guadalupe.
